Updated Upstream (Paper)

Upstream has released updates that appear to apply and compile correctly

Paper Changes:
PaperMC/Paper@55a16d8 Fix Varint21FrameDecoder cached length buf usage
PaperMC/Paper@e6e37ba Add api to resolve components (#7648)
PaperMC/Paper@7168438 [ci skip] Rework workflows to support optional paperclip build (#8583)
PaperMC/Paper@da230d5 More vanilla friendly methods to update trades (#8478)
PaperMC/Paper@8aff07a Add /paper dumplisteners command (#8507)
PaperMC/Paper@b8919a7 pr command action fixes (#8591)
PaperMC/Paper@185fa48 Fix chest relooting mechanics (#8580)
PaperMC/Paper@b4beac0 Fixes potential issues arising from optimizing getPlayerByUUID (#8585)
PaperMC/Paper@f637b1a Fix async entity add due to fungus trees (#7626)
PaperMC/Paper@414ea80 ItemStack damage API (#7801)
PaperMC/Paper@d98c370 Add displayName methods for advancements (#8584)
PaperMC/Paper@44bb599 Add Tick TemporalUnit (#5445)
PaperMC/Paper@9f7eef8 Friction API (#6611)
PaperMC/Paper@4048d3e Allow using degrees for ArmorStand rotations (#7847)
PaperMC/Paper@f59c802 Schoolable Fish API (#7089)
PaperMC/Paper@21b964a Added ability to control player's insomnia and phantoms spawning (#6500)
PaperMC/Paper@f1583fc Add `/paper dumplisteners tofile` and increase detail of command output (#8592)
This commit is contained in:
BillyGalbreath
2022-11-26 18:48:36 -06:00
parent a8b26671d1
commit 47dc2e92f5
90 changed files with 546 additions and 565 deletions

View File

@@ -78,10 +78,10 @@ index fb77d022ea872deb7f47d033df4a0f201da026c2..0f20be71aebc236bfcb8ace98e0be8ad
blockEntity.teleportCooldown = 100;
diff --git a/src/main/java/org/bukkit/craftbukkit/entity/CraftEntity.java b/src/main/java/org/bukkit/craftbukkit/entity/CraftEntity.java
index 9aee601caad5b314cef2e32a57fdb8ab8aeae896..fbddb90fdbaa99c5f243b6e93c55fc1f7430e337 100644
index 32169b7dbfe95bdc5ded6d64524e015f1b939e7a..edfd2d9450805f05df607b5160a0c0ecf9170915 100644
--- a/src/main/java/org/bukkit/craftbukkit/entity/CraftEntity.java
+++ b/src/main/java/org/bukkit/craftbukkit/entity/CraftEntity.java
@@ -564,6 +564,10 @@ public abstract class CraftEntity implements org.bukkit.entity.Entity {
@@ -570,6 +570,10 @@ public abstract class CraftEntity implements org.bukkit.entity.Entity {
// Paper end
if ((!ignorePassengers && this.entity.isVehicle()) || this.entity.isRemoved()) { // Paper - Teleport passenger API
@@ -93,7 +93,7 @@ index 9aee601caad5b314cef2e32a57fdb8ab8aeae896..fbddb90fdbaa99c5f243b6e93c55fc1f
}
diff --git a/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java b/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java
index c82e2ce3f94f658a0cf66445a4507fc696760820..d588f1b7670af21512295e446c15812cd9e2f6a2 100644
index 461f2d0a72b01251324a197752a23677ac24beb6..c1c5c0edab6dc204dd0e7de09af31f8b3b95ad86 100644
--- a/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java
+++ b/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java
@@ -1309,6 +1309,10 @@ public class CraftPlayer extends CraftHumanEntity implements Player {
@@ -108,7 +108,7 @@ index c82e2ce3f94f658a0cf66445a4507fc696760820..d588f1b7670af21512295e446c15812c
}
diff --git a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
index bd6e5bd2116368e2b60fda1bc5a036b44708682e..88588ca9af08f255e099733c6c0692cde7115394 100644
index 6d7922ce6a1442a9c4e8968d86ffb494f3616833..565bdd1faedda5d6ed010970a81527d788a05375 100644
--- a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
+++ b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
@@ -120,6 +120,7 @@ public class PurpurWorldConfig {